In the blink of an eye, here's everything about "I Dream of Jeannie"Everyone remembers "I Dream of Jeannie," but how much do you really know about Major Nelson, Major Healey, and Jeannie herself?TV historian Stephen Cox and photo archivist Howard Frank uncork all the secrets to this supernatural Sixties sitcom. Included here are:* Rare, outspoken interviews with the cast, actual NASA astronauts, and the show's prolific producer, Sidney Sheldon.* Astounding, never-before-published photos that show more fully illustrate the scope of this show's legacy and its permanent place in pop culture history.* The complete "Bewitched" vs. "Jeannie" squabble.* Sixteen pages of mystical color images.* Exclusive peeks into Jeannie's bottleYes, Master, this thoroughly researched and beautifully illustrated book is a dream come true for every fan of Jeannie. show less
